Willow Terrace in Lebanon, Pennsylvania is best suited for budget-conscious seniors who want a community-first living environment and don’t require large, upscale apartments. It functions as a straightforward senior living apartment complex where daily life centers on neighborly connections and practical, low-frills routines rather than resort-style amenities. For residents who value a friendly, social setting more than a spacious floorplan, Willow Terrace can feel like a solid, affordable home base. Those who insist on generous square footage, modern finishes, or campus-style services will likely feel constrained and may want to explore other options.
Those considering alternatives should weigh the demand for more space, stronger pest control, and reliable climate management. A newer or larger facility with better-maintained interiors, quieter common areas, and a more polished look could better serve someone who wants fewer compromises on comfort and maintenance. Families and prospective residents who prioritize consistent temperature control, minimal pest concerns, and a more contemporary feel should compare Willow Terrace against other communities that offer larger units and more robust infrastructure.
On the upside, the strongest recurring positive thread is the social fabric. Residents are described as friendly and welcoming, with multiple quick-friendships forming a sense of belonging. The narrative around family visits and even endorsements like “Dad loves it here” point to a community where relationships matter and neighbors look out for one another. For seniors who fear isolation, this is a meaningful counterweight to the smaller living spaces and the modest list of on-site conveniences. The warmth of the resident community can translate into a livable daily experience, especially for those who place high value on companionship.
The drawbacks are real and compound the decision. The living spaces are notably small, which becomes a pronounced constraint for anyone accustomed to more room or who frequently hosts family and friends. Pest concerns and inconsistent climate control emerge as serious red flags: roaches and overheated units imply ongoing maintenance and safety worries that are not easily dismissed by-location charm. A separate friction point is parking and traffic etiquette at the street-level access area, where informal practices can create frustration amid busy visits. Taken together, these cons can erode the comfort of daily life, especially for residents with higher care needs or those sensitive to comfort and hygiene.
Prospective residents should verify several practical details before moving in. Request a transparent overview of pest control schedules, room-by-room heat management, and whether indoor temperatures stabilize reliably across seasons. Inspect a sample unit for air flow, insulation, and signs of pests during a tour. Clarify what utilities are included, how maintenance requests are handled, and the expected response times for urgent concerns. Finally, observe the parking situation during peak hours and assess whether the lot configuration truly supports easy access for visitors. These checks help separate manageable inconveniences from unlivable realities.
In the end, Willow Terrace presents a pragmatic option for seniors who prioritize community, affordability, and a straightforward living environment over space and luxury. It is a fit for those who can tolerate compact apartments and are prepared to engage with a neighborhood that tends to be warm and welcoming. For anyone who cannot tolerate recurring pest issues, heat irregularities, or the sense that space is too cramped for daily living and hosting, alternatives with larger units, stronger maintenance, and more consistent comfort should be seriously considered. The decision hinges on balancing the value of companionship and cost against the realities of room size and maintenance reliability.
